The day after being sworn in as Germany’s new chancellor, Friedrich Merz boarded a plane to Paris.
There, he stood side-by-side with French President Emmanuel Macron and unveiled a sweeping new bilateral defense pact—one that notably excludes the United States.
The two leaders called out “the systematic threat Russia poses to our European system,” and in doing so, made clear that Europe’s two largest economies are no longer counting on NATO as a reliable guarantor of security.
The most striking moment came when Macron announced the formation of a Franco-German Defense and Security Council, saying it would “meet regularly to provide operational solutions to our common strategic challenges.”
